The late-stage symptoms of glioma are usually severe glioma symptoms. At this time, patients experience increased intracranial pressure, headache, vomiting, and mental symptoms. On the other hand, due to compression and infiltration of brain tissue by tumors, local symptoms will appear, causing neurological damage.

First of all, the general symptom after suffering from glioma is increased intracranial pressure. Specific physical symptoms include headache, vomiting, optic disc edema, and many patients will also experience more serious changes in vision and visual field, diplopia, and even epilepsy, cranial enlargement, changes in vital signs, etc. These symptoms are very serious after they appear, which will cause great pain to the patient's body.
